In almost every season of both Rob and Big and Fantasy Factory, there has been an episode that features The Dyrdek’s. Patty and Gene, and sometimes Rob’s sister Denise.

Rob and Big season 1 - Travel - Rob and Big visit Canada to take part in the “Skate” video game, and visit Kettering, OH to visit with Rob’s family on the way back.

Rob and Big season 2 - Rob’s parents didn’t play a part in season 2, but that’s okay because this was the season of “Black Lavender” which is arguably the funniest episode in Rob and Big history.

Rob and Big season 3 - Parents - Rob’s parents visit LA and Rob tries to re-create a poem from his past with the hope that his mom will cry when he reads it to her.

Fantasy Factory season 1 - This is Not Mom Certified - Rob’s parents come to visit the factory for the premiere of Rob’s movie “Street Dreams.”

Fantasy Factory season 2 - The Dyrdek Family Vacation - Rob travels to Myrtle Beach to spend time with his family on an annual vacation that he has missed out on the past few years.

Fantasy Factory season 3 - Operation Save Patty - Rob and Drama travel back to Kettering, OH to take care of Patty who has shattered an ankle.

And now..Fantasy Factory season 4 - Ginger Lion - Rob’s parents visit the factory and Rob makes Patty the spokesperson for Bill My Parents.
